Teak Oil – Hardwood Furniture & Exterior Wood Care. Teak Oil is a penetrating blend of natural oils and resins formulated to nourish dense hardwoods, enrich grain and leave a low-sheen, water-repellent finish. Ideal for garden furniture, doors, window boards and other exterior or interior hardwood joinery, it helps guard against drying and weathering while maintaining a natural look and feel.. Key Features & Benefits. Penetrating Protection: Feeds hardwoods (e.g., teak, iroko, acacia, oak) to reduce cracking and checking.. Water-Repellent Satin: Leaves a natural, low-sheen finish that sheds light showers.. Enhances Grain: Deepens colour and highlights figure without a plastic film.. Easy to Maintain: Simple wipe-on refresher coats—no stripping required.. Versatile Use: Suitable for exterior garden furniture and interior hardwood trim.. Typical Uses. Garden tables, chairs, benches and loungers. Exterior doors, thresholds and hardwood trims. Interior hardwood worktops, shelves and window boards (non-food prep). Boat brightwork in sheltered areas (maintenance required). Surface Preparation. Clean and allow wood to dry. Remove grey weathering, mildew and contaminants.. Sand evenly (finish P180–P240); remove all dust. Strip old varnish/paint before oiling.. Degrease oily tropical hardwoods with suitable solvent; test on an off-cut for colour.. Application. Stir well. Apply a thin coat with a lint-free cloth or brush along the grain.. Allow 10–20 minutes to penetrate, then wipe off all excess to avoid a sticky surface.. Allow to dry (typically 6–12 hours, longer in cool/humid conditions). De-nib lightly if required.. Apply 2–3 coats initially; add extra on very porous or weathered timber.. Aftercare & Maintenance. For exterior items, re-oil seasonally or when the surface looks dry and water no longer beads.. Clean with mild detergent; avoid harsh chemicals and abrasive pads.. Expect natural colour change in sunlight; periodic cleaning and oiling will refresh appearance.. Limitations & Safety. Not a heavy film or high-build varnish; regular maintenance is required outdoors.. May deepen/amber pale timbers—always test first.. Not recommended for food-contact surfaces unless specifically approved.. Oily rag safety: Oil-soaked cloths can self-heat—lay flat to dry outdoors or submerge in water before disposal..
